Port Open In Firewall But Cannot Connect
Have you ever encountered a situation where you have opened a port in your firewall, only to find that you still cannot establish a connection? It can be frustrating and puzzling, especially when you've followed all the necessary steps to open the port correctly. So, why is it that even with an open port, you cannot connect?
When it comes to the phenomenon of a port being open in a firewall but unable to establish a connection, there are a few key factors to consider. Firstly, it could be due to application-layer issues, where the software or service you are trying to connect with might have specific configuration requirements or additional protocols to establish a successful connection. Secondly, network conditions and settings, such as NAT (Network Address Translation) or IP routing, can also have an impact on the ability to connect, even with an open port. These factors combined create a complex web of variables that require careful troubleshooting and investigation to pinpoint the root cause of the issue.
If you have opened a port in your firewall but still cannot establish a connection, there could be several reasons for this issue. First, ensure that the port is correctly configured and matches the protocol being used. Additionally, check if any other security measures, such as an antivirus program, are blocking the connection. It's also important to confirm that the service you are trying to connect to is running and actively listening on the specified port. Finally, double-check that there are no network issues or restrictions preventing the connection. Troubleshooting these factors should help resolve the problem.
Understanding Port Open in Firewall but Cannot Connect
A firewall is an essential security mechanism that acts as a barrier between a network and external threats. It carefully filters incoming and outgoing network traffic based on predetermined rules. While a firewall is effective in protecting a network, configuring it correctly can sometimes be challenging. One common issue users encounter is when a port is open in the firewall, but they are unable to establish a connection. In this article, we will explore the reasons behind this problem and possible solutions.
Improper Port Forwarding Configuration
One of the primary reasons why a port may be open in the firewall but cannot connect is due to incorrect port forwarding configuration. Port forwarding allows external devices to access specific services or applications within a private network. However, if the port forwarding rules are misconfigured or incomplete, the connection cannot be established.
To resolve this issue, it is crucial to double-check the port forwarding configuration in the firewall settings. Make sure that the port number, protocol (TCP or UDP), and destination IP address are correctly entered. Additionally, ensure that the device hosting the service or application is running and accessible.
Furthermore, some routers or firewalls require a reboot after modifying port forwarding settings for them to take effect. Restarting the device can help ensure that the changes are applied correctly and allow the connection to be established through the open port.
If the port forwarding configuration appears to be correct and the connection still cannot be established, it may be helpful to consult the documentation or support resources provided by the firewall manufacturer or network equipment vendor for specific troubleshooting steps.
Network Address Translation (NAT) Issues
The Network Address Translation (NAT) feature is commonly used in routers and firewalls to translate private IP addresses to public IP addresses and vice versa. NAT can sometimes cause issues with establishing connections to open ports if not properly configured.
If the firewall is operating in a NAT environment, it is essential to ensure that the necessary NAT rules are configured correctly. These rules should map the external IP address and port to the internal IP address and port of the device hosting the service or application. Without the appropriate NAT rules, the connection attempt may fail even if the port is open.
To troubleshoot NAT-related issues, verify that the NAT configuration accurately reflects the internal and external IP addresses and ports. Also, confirm that the NAT rules are applied to the correct interfaces and devices within the network. Updating or recreating the NAT rules may help resolve connectivity problems when the port is open in the firewall.
If you are not familiar with NAT configuration or encounter difficulties resolving the issue, consider seeking assistance from network administrators or IT professionals experienced in firewall and networking configurations.
Application or Service Configuration
Another reason why you may not be able to connect to an open port despite the firewall configuration is an issue with the application or service itself. Sometimes, the service or application may not be able to accept incoming connections due to incorrect configuration settings or other factors.
When encountering this issue, it is crucial to review the configuration settings of the specific service or application you are trying to connect to. Ensure that any required ports are opened both in the firewall and within the application or service itself.
Additionally, check if there are any specific access control lists or firewall rules within the application or service that restrict incoming connections. Adjusting these settings to allow the connection from your IP address or network range can potentially resolve the problem.
Furthermore, consider restarting the service or application to clear any temporary issues that may be preventing incoming connections. If the problem persists, consult the documentation or support resources for the particular application or service to troubleshoot the issue further.
Network Connection or ISP Issues
In some cases, the inability to connect to an open port despite appropriate firewall configurations can be attributed to network connection issues or limitations imposed by internet service providers (ISPs).
If you are unable to establish a connection, perform a basic network connectivity test. Ping the IP address or domain name of the device hosting the service or application to check if there is a network connection between your device and the server. A successful ping indicates that the network is reachable.
If the ping test is successful, try accessing other services or websites to verify that the internet connection is functioning correctly. Sometimes, ISPs may block certain ports or implement traffic shaping policies that restrict certain types of network traffic.
If there are network or ISP limitations affecting the connectivity, reaching out to the respective providers for assistance or exploring alternative connectivity options may be necessary.
Firewall Software or Hardware Limitations
Lastly, it is crucial to consider that certain firewall software or hardware may have inherent limitations that prevent connections from being established despite correct configurations.
For example, some firewall software may have restricted compatibility with certain operating systems or specific applications. In such cases, it may be necessary to explore alternative firewall solutions or seek guidance from the firewall manufacturer or vendor to address the limitations.
If the firewall hardware has reached its maximum capacity or performance limits, it may struggle to handle incoming connection requests despite the open ports. Upgrading the firewall hardware or considering load balancing techniques can alleviate this issue.
Before implementing any changes, it is recommended to consult with IT professionals or experienced network administrators who can provide guidance tailored to your specific environment.
Exploring Another Dimension of 'Port Open in Firewall but Cannot Connect'
Now, let's delve into another aspect related to the problem of a port being open in the firewall but unable to connect. By understanding different dimensions of this issue, we can broaden our troubleshooting options to resolve the problem effectively.
Intrusion Detection/Prevention Systems (IDS/IPS)
One aspect that can contribute to the inability to connect to an open port is the presence of Intrusion Detection Systems (IDS) or Intrusion Prevention Systems (IPS). Although these security mechanisms complement the firewall's protective capabilities, they can also interfere with legitimate connection attempts.
IDS/IPS systems monitor network traffic for suspicious or malicious activities and take action based on predefined rules. These systems can mistakenly identify genuine connections as threats and block them, preventing successful connections to open ports.
To address this issue, it is necessary to review the IDS/IPS configurations and rules. Ensure that any legitimate connections are not being blocked or flagged as suspicious. Whitelisting the IP address or configuring appropriate bypass rules within the IDS/IPS systems can help in establishing the desired connections.
Operating System Firewalls
In addition to hardware firewalls, modern operating systems often come equipped with built-in firewalls as well. These software firewalls provide an additional layer of security but can also cause connectivity issues if not properly configured.
If a port is open in the hardware firewall, but the connection cannot be established, it is essential to verify the settings of the operating system's firewall. Ensure that the necessary inbound and outbound rules are configured to allow traffic through the open port.
Some operating system firewalls may have default settings that block incoming connections. In such cases, it is crucial to modify the firewall settings to permit the desired connections. Refer to the documentation or support resources for your specific operating system to learn how to configure the firewall correctly.
Lastly, make sure that the operating system firewall is running and its service is active. If the firewall service is stopped or not functioning correctly, it can prevent connections from being established despite the open port in the hardware firewall.
Protocol or Application-Specific Restrictions
Certain protocols or applications may have specific restrictions that prevent connections from being established despite the open port in the firewall. These restrictions can be designed to enhance security or limit certain functionalities.
For example, some applications or services may require a specific sequence of actions or messages to be exchanged before allowing a connection to be established. If these conditions are not met, the connection attempt may fail, even if the port is open.
When encountering this issue, carefully review the protocol or application specifications and requirements. Ensure that the necessary prerequisites are met and that any specific restrictions or rules are correctly configured in the firewall.
In some cases, it may be necessary to consult the documentation or support resources for the particular protocol or application to obtain additional troubleshooting guidance or seek assistance from the developers or vendors.
Firewall Firmware/Software Updates
Outdated firewall firmware or software can lead to compatibility issues and affect the ability to establish connections through open ports. Firewall manufacturers release updates and patches to address bugs, enhance performance, and improve compatibility with various applications and protocols.
If you are facing difficulties connecting through an open port despite correct configurations, consider checking for available firmware or software updates for your firewall. Applying these updates can address known issues and enhance the overall functionality and compatibility of the firewall.
Before performing any firmware or software updates, it is crucial to carefully review the manufacturer's documentation and instructions to ensure a smooth and successful updating process. Take necessary precautions, such as backing up configurations and consulting with the vendor or experienced professionals if needed.
In Conclusion
Encountering a situation where a port is open in the firewall but cannot connect can be frustrating. It is important to troubleshoot the problem systematically and consider various factors that may contribute to the issue.
By checking the port forwarding configuration, ensuring proper NAT settings, reviewing application or service configurations, investigating network and ISP limitations, and addressing firewall software or hardware limitations, you can increase the chances of resolving the connectivity issue. Additionally, considering IDS/IPS systems, operating system firewalls, protocol or application-specific restrictions, and keeping firewall firmware or software up-to-date helps in exploring different dimensions of the problem.
Remember that each network environment is unique, and troubleshooting steps may vary. If you encounter difficulties or are unsure about making configuration changes, it is always advisable to seek assistance from IT professionals or experienced network administrators who can provide tailored guidance suitable for your specific situation.
Troubleshooting Port Connectivity Issues
In the world of computer networks, opening a port in a firewall is a common practice to allow incoming and outgoing network traffic. However, sometimes even if a port is open, a connection cannot be established. This can be frustrating, but it is essential to troubleshoot the issue to identify the underlying problem.
There are several reasons why a port might appear open but cannot connect. One possibility is that the service running on that port is not functioning correctly. Another reason could be that there are network configuration issues or software conflicts. It is also crucial to ensure that the correct port number and protocol (TCP or UDP) are being used for the connection.
To resolve this issue, it is recommended to perform the following steps:
- Verify if the service running on the port is active and functional.
- Check for any software conflicts or misconfigurations.
- Confirm the correct port number and protocol.
- Review the firewall rules and settings.
- Test the port connectivity using a different device or network.
- Consider seeking professional assistance or contacting the software/application vendor for further support.
By following these steps, network administrators can effectively troubleshoot port connectivity issues and resolve them promptly.
Key Takeaways:
- Check if the service is running on the correct port.
- Ensure that the port is open on both the firewall and router.
- Verify that the IP address and port number are correct.
- Confirm that the application or service is not being blocked by antivirus or security software.
- Troubleshoot network connectivity issues, such as DNS resolution or network congestion.
Frequently Asked Questions
Having an open port in your firewall is essential for allowing incoming and outgoing network traffic. However, despite having the port open, you may still face connectivity issues. Here are some frequently asked questions about the situation "Port Open in Firewall but Cannot Connect."
1. Why am I unable to connect to a port even though it is open in my firewall?
There are several reasons why you may not be able to connect to a port despite it being open in your firewall:
- The program or service you are trying to connect to may not be functioning correctly or may not be running.
- The port you are trying to connect to may be blocked by another device, such as a router or an ISP.
- You may have configured the port forwarding rules incorrectly.
- Your firewall's rules may not be properly configured to allow the connection.
These factors can prevent successful connection to a port even if it is open in your firewall.
2. How can I troubleshoot the issue of being unable to connect to a port?
To troubleshoot the issue of being unable to connect to a port despite it being open in your firewall, you can follow these steps:
- Ensure that the program or service you are trying to connect to is functioning correctly and is running.
- Check if any other devices, such as routers or ISPs, are blocking the port you are trying to connect to.
- Review and double-check the port forwarding rules to ensure they are configured correctly.
- Verify that your firewall's rules are properly configured to allow the connection.
- Consider disabling any other firewalls, such as antivirus firewalls, temporarily to see if they are causing the issue.
By following these troubleshooting steps, you can identify and resolve the issue preventing your connection to a port.
3. Can the issue of being unable to connect to a port be caused by my network configuration?
Yes, network configuration issues can contribute to the inability to connect to a port even if it is open in your firewall. Some potential network configuration-related causes include:
- Incorrectly configured network settings, such as IP addresses or subnet masks, can prevent proper connection.
- Problems with DNS resolution can lead to connection failures.
- Issues with network routers, switches, or other devices can disrupt the connection.
- Network congestion or bandwidth limitations can affect connectivity.
If you suspect network configuration issues, you may need to consult with a network administrator or IT professional to resolve the problem.
4. Could a firewall software other than the one on my computer be causing the issue?
Yes, it is possible that a firewall software other than the one on your computer, such as a hardware firewall or a firewall on a different device, can be causing the issue. These firewalls may have their own configuration settings or rules that can block the connection despite the port being open on your computer's firewall.
5. What are some other factors that could prevent the successful connection to a port despite it being open in the firewall?
In addition to the previously mentioned reasons, some other factors that could prevent a successful connection to a port despite it being open in the firewall include:
- Antivirus software or security settings that block certain ports or protocols.
- Incorrect or outdated drivers for network adapters.
- Software or hardware conflicts that interfere with network connectivity.
- Issues with the application using the port, such as bugs or compatibility problems.
- Insufficient system resources, such as insufficient memory or processing power, affecting the connection.
Identifying and resolving these additional factors may be necessary to establish a successful connection to a port.
In summary, if you are experiencing the issue of a port being open in your firewall but still unable to connect, there are a few possible explanations. First, it could be that the application or service you are trying to connect to is not properly configured to listen on the specified port. In this case, you may need to check the application settings or consult the documentation for further instructions.
Another potential reason for the inability to connect could be that there is a network infrastructure issue. This could include problems with routers, switches, or other devices that are between your computer and the destination server. To troubleshoot this, you can try connecting to the server from another network to see if the issue persists.